I believe this is why:

The culture that surrounds a launch is really exciting. People look forward to specific games with their friends and get hyped for its release many weeks before the content actually hits. When a game finally comes out, it becomes water cooler conversation. People asking if you got this game, how far did they get, did they get to this part or that part yet, isn't this new game awesome, etc. People like to be part of this. People look forward to this.

So being excluded from this, even for a month, is really undesirable. Most gamers (from what I've seen, anyway) only buy and play one game at a time. They look forward to a specific release and then play that game until the next specific release, occasionally filling gaps with recommendations of older games from friends.

But people like sharing games and talking about the games they're playing a lot. And having to wait thirty days means missing out on that conversation. It means missing out on that water cooler. And then when you are finally playing the game, even only thirty days later, all your friends have moved on.

People don't want to be left behind by their friends. So they purchase consoles and content based on the majority rule of their environment. And being an outlier, or a perceived outlier, hampers their communal experience.
